How to Make Banana Bread Brownies

Creating these delightful Banana Bread Brownies is a straightforward process. Follow these easy steps for a delicious result:

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up ripe bananas, mashed
  • 1/2 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up walnuts, chopped
  • Creamy vanilla frosting

Directions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×9 inch baking pan. This initial step is crucial as it ensures that your brownies come out smoothly.
  2. In a bowl, mix the mashed bananas, sour cream, oil, sugar, eggs, and vanilla extract until well combined. This blend of wet ingredients will add moisture and flavor to your brownies.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. This step ensures that your leavening agent is evenly distributed throughout the flour.
  4.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are perfectly fine.
  5. Fold in the chopped walnuts. They bring a delightful crunch and nutty flavor, adding a lovely contrasting texture.
  6.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an and spread it evenly. This step is critical to ensure uniform baking.
  7.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. You want a little moisture but not gooey batter.
  8. Allow to cool before topping with creamy vanilla frosting. The frosting will add a rich and decadent finish that is simply irresistible.
  9. Cut into squares and serve. The brownies can be enjoyed warm or at room temperature.

How to Store Banana Bread Brownies

To keep your Banana Bread Brownies fresh, storage is key. Once they are completely cooled and frosted, you can store them in an airtight container at room temperature. This way, the brownies will maintain their moist texture.

If you find yourself with leftovers (which is rare, but possible), they can also be refrigerated for a longer shelf life. Be sure to let them sit at room temperature before serving again.

For those who want to prepare ahead of time, these brownies can be made and frozen.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il, and place them in an airtight container or freezer bag. They can last up to three months in the freezer. When you’re ready to enjoy, simply let them thaw on the counter for an hour or two.

Tips to Make Banana Bread Brownies

When creating these brownies, a few tips can enhance your success:

  1. Use Overripe Bananas: The more brown spots on your bananas, the sweeter and more flavorful your brownies will be. The natural sugars develop as bananas ripen, adding depth to your dish.

  2. Don’t Overmix: Mixing the batter just until combined ensures your brownies are tender and not tough. The goal is to incorporate the ingredients without developing too much gluten.

  3. Check for Doneness Early: Ovens can vary, so start checking your brownies a few minutes before the end of the recommended baking time. Pull them out when a toothpick comes out with just a couple of moist crumbs.

  4. Customize the Frosting: While creamy vanilla frosting is delightful, feel free to experiment. A chocolate ganache or a simple dusting of powdered sugar can be equally appealing.

  5. Add Extra Flavor: Consider incorporating spices such as cinnamon or nutmeg for warmth. A little espresso powder can also amplify the chocolate flavor, making these brownies even more decadent.

FAQs

  1. Can I use frozen bananas for this recipe?
    Absolutely! Frozen bananas work just as well as fresh. Just thaw them completely and mash them before adding to the batter.

  2. How can I tell when my brownies are done baking?
    A toothpick inserted into the center of the brownies should come out with a few moist crumbs. If it comes out wet with batter, they need more time.

  3. Can I make these brownies without eggs?
    Yes, you can use flax eggs or applesauce as substitutes for eggs if you want a vegan option. One egg can be replaced with 1 tablespoon of flaxseed mixed with 2.5 tablespoons of water or 1/4 cup of applesauce.
